It may be time to upgrade my old Windows 98 (first edition), and I'm trying to decide whether to choose 98 Second Edition, ME, or XP. My most important files are all in WP 5.1 for DOS, so I need to be able to continue to run this program without problems. Will all three Windows programs allow that? Any recommendations on which to upgrade to? I'm mainly interested in avoiding glitches and problems. I need no fancy applications; Windows 98 does everything I need and I like it, but I have difficulty opening Word attachments and need to get software (Word or Corel 12) that will help me there, and I've heard that Windows 98 First Edition is too primitive to support either of those. Recommendations?
